Transaction 630f25616fcd67c41d9e0e0a271ff726817a55014cc1e97f2914f214635e2ba1
1 Input
1 Output
-
630f25616fcd67c41d9e0e0a271ff726817a55014cc1e97f2914f214635e2ba1:0
- value
- 674330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8393ee1f9c52969f9e2eeb3c5e9c4cd3afb1e27 OP_EQUAL
- address
- 3KwheQX9cAj6AVPsrBqjtz6pbwAKXn3P4i